ORDER : The Court Made the following order :- The petitioner apprehends arrest at the hands of the respondent police for the offences punishable under Sections 366, 342, 354 (C), 376(D), 506(ii) I.P.C and 67 of Information Technology (Amendment) Act 2008, in Crime No.11 of 2018, seeks bail. 2.The case of the prosecution is that the defacto complainant was standing near Muniyandi Temple, Sivagangai at about 11.00.am., for purchasing fish, the first accused parked his Auto and pickup her. When the defacto complainant was tried to get down from the Auto, other three persons were also get in the auto. Thereafter, the accused persons committed rape on the defacto complainant. Hence, the complaint.

3.The learned counsel for the petitioner would submit that there is a delay for lodging the complaint and also she is immoral woman. Therefore, on payment of money, they had sexual intercourse with the defacto complainant. She is aged about 35 years. Further he would submit that the petitioner is an innocent and he has no previous antecedents and also submitted that he has arrested and remanded to judicial custody on 20.08.2018.

4.The learned Additional Public Prosecutor submitted that the case of the hang rape and the defacto complainant is not a prostitute. Therefore, he vehemently opposed to grant of bail to the petitioner.

5.Taking note of the facts and circumstances, this Court is not inclined to grant bail to the petitioner. Therefore, this Criminal Original Petition is dismissed.
